‘Old Ladies’ are free-diving on Cape Cod. They’ve excavated 6,000 pounds of trash.
A group of women aged 64 and older, calling themselves the Old Ladies Against Underwater Garbage, have removed about 6,000 pounds of trash from Cape Cod ponds since 2017. Members free-dive to retrieve items like beer cans, golf balls, and an 80-pound toilet. The group was founded by 85-year-old retired psychologist Susan Baur.
